What Is Puffy Paint?
Puffy paint is a special blend of white glue and shaving cream that dries into a fun, squishy, 3D texture on paper. It’s a perfect art activity for toddlers, preschoolers, or even big kids who just want to get their hands messy in the best possible way.

Ingredients & Supplies
You’ll Need:
- ✅ ½ cup white school glue (Elmer’s works great!)
- ✅ ½ cup foam shaving cream (the classic kind, not gel)
- ✅ Food coloring or liquid watercolors
- ✅ Small bowl and spoon or craft stick (for mixing)
- ✅ Paintbrushes, cotton swabs, or fingers (for applying)
- ✅ Thick paper or cardstock (regular paper can curl with moisture)
- ✅ Optional: Glitter for sparkle
Optional Variations
- 🌈 Split into smaller batches and color each one differently for a rainbow palette
- ✨ Add a pinch of glitter for a sparkly effect
- 🍭 Try scented shaving cream (like coconut or mint!) for a sensory boost
- 🌟 Want to go big? Use this paint on poster board for a jumbo masterpiece!
How to Make Fluffy Puffy Paint – Step-by-Step
1. Pour the Glue
In a small bowl, add ½ cup of white school glue.
2. Add the Shaving Cream
Next, gently squirt ½ cup of foam shaving cream into the bowl. Try not to pack it down—you want all that fluff!
3. Mix It Up
Using a spoon or craft stick, gently fold the glue and shaving cream together. Don’t stir too vigorously—you’ll lose the puffiness! Think of folding whipped cream into cake batter.
4. Add Color
Drop in a few drops of food coloring or liquid watercolor. Stir lightly until evenly colored. Want more colors? Divide the mix into smaller bowls and repeat with different shades.
5. Time to Paint!
Use paintbrushes, cotton swabs, or fingers to apply the fluffy paint to thick paper. The more you layer it, the puffier the result!
6. Let It Dry
Place the artwork somewhere flat and ventilated. Drying takes 12–24 hours, depending on how thick your paint is and your room’s humidity. Once dry, the paint stays puffy and soft to the touch.

Tips for the Best Puffy Paint Results
- Use thicker paper like cardstock or watercolor paper so the moisture doesn’t cause warping.
- Fold, don’t stir too aggressively—preserve that fluff!
- Store unused paint in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 24 hours.
- Encourage kids to explore texture—they’ll love using fingers just as much as brushes!
Storage & Longevity
- Once dry, puffy paint art will stay raised and soft for weeks (even months) if stored flat.
- Avoid bending or stacking the artwork to keep the texture intact.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Can I store the puffy paint for later use?
Yes—for best results, store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. It may lose some fluffiness after that.
Can I use gel shaving cream?
It’s not recommended—foam shaving cream gives the best texture. Gel won’t fluff the same way.
Is this paint safe for toddlers?
Yes! All ingredients are non-toxic and safe when used with supervision. Just keep it out of mouths.
Can I use this paint on canvas?
Absolutely! Just make sure the canvas is primed and flat. Puffy paint adds great texture to canvas art projects.
